Microsoft Windows HPC Server 2008 R2 for the Cluster Developer - 50291

Course Outline

Module 1: Introduction to High-Performance Computing and HPC Server 2008 R2

This module introduces the field of high-performance computing, the product Microsoft Windows HPC Server 2008 R2, and developing software for HPCS-based clusters.

Lessons

 Motivation for HPC
 Brief product history of CCS, HPCS, and HPCS 2008 R2
 Brief overview of HPC Server 2008 R2 — components, job submission, scheduler
 Product differentiators
 Measuring performance — linear speedup
 Predicting performance — Amdahl’s law

Lab : Introduction to HPC And Windows HPC Server 2008

 Submitting and monitoring jobs
 Running an HPC app
 Measuring performance
 Measuring the importance of data locality

Module 2: Developing Software for HPC Server 2008 R2

This module presents designs, technologies, and challenges when developing HPC software. It also presents the use of Parametric Sweep to solve a real-world HPC problem.

Lessons

 Design challenges
 Design patterns
 Common problem decompositions
 Common communication patterns
 Computation vs. communication
 Available HPC technologies: multi-threading, GPUs, MPI, SOA, etc.
 Data-mining and Parametric Sweep

Module 3: The HPCS Job Scheduler

This module introduces the heart of HPCS-based clusters — the Job Scheduler.

Lessons

 Throughput vs. performance
 Nodes vs. sockets vs. cores
 Jobs vs. Tasks
 Job and task states
 Default scheduling policies
 The impact of job priorities and job preemption
 Job resources and dynamic growing / shrinking
 Submission and activation filters

Lab : Working with the Job Scheduler

 Environment variables in HPC Server 2008 R2
 Exit codes and denoting success / failure
 Checkpointing in case of failure
 Multi-task jobs and task dependences

Module 4: Multicore for Performance

This module provides an overview of Microsoft’s multicore libraries available for C# and C++.

Lessons

 Parallel, multicore programming for responsiveness and performance
 Structured, fork-join parallelism
 Multicore in C# using the Task Parallel Library in .NET 4
 Multicore in VC++ using OpenMP and the Parallel Patterns Library
 Scheduling parallel, multicore apps on Windows HPC Server

Lab : OPTIONAL: Multicore Programming in C# using Task Parallel Library

 Creating a parallel, multicore app in C# and .NET 4
 Running and measuring performance locally
 Running and measuring performance on the cluster

Module 5: Interfacing with HPCS-based Clusters

This module demonstrates the various ways you can interface with Windows HPC Server 2008 R2, in particular using the HPC Server 2008 API.

Lessons

 Cluster Manager
 Job Manager
 Job Description Files
 clusrun
 Console window
 PowerShell
 Scripts
 Programmatic access via HPCS API v2.0
 Showing job progress
 Implementing job fault tolerance

Lab : Interfacing with Windows HPC Server 2008

 Clusrun is your friend
 Scripting
 Using the HPCS API to submit and monitor a job

Module 6: Introduction to MPI

This module introduces *the* most common approach to developing cluster-wide, high-performance applications: the Message-Passing Interface.

Lessons

 Shared-memory vs. distributed-memory
 The essence of MPI programming — message-passing SPMD
 Microsoft MPI
 Using MSMPI in Visual Studio with VC++
 Execution model
 MPI Send and Receive
 mpiexec
 Scheduling MPI apps on Windows HPC Server

Lab : Introduction to MPI

 Creating a simple MPI app using Send and Receive
 Running and measuring performance locally
 Running and measuring performance on the cluster

Module 7: MPI on the Microsoft Platform

This module discusses MSMPI and data parallelism, in particular how best to build data parallel MPI apps using its collective operations.

Lessons

 MSMPI: Microsoft MPI
 Data parallelism in MPI
 A real world example
 Broadcast
 Scatter
 Gather
 Barriers
 Reductions
 Defining your own reduction operator
 Common pitfalls

Lab : Data Parallelism with MPI’s Collective Operations

 Parallelizing an existing MPI application
 Mapping Sends and Receives to Broadcast, Scanner, Gather, and All_reduce
 Running and measuring performance locally
 Running and measuring performance on the cluster

Module 8: MPI Debugging, Tracing, and Performance Tuning

This module dives into the practical realities of using MPI — debugging, tracing, and performance tuning.

Lessons

 Local MPI debugging with Visual Studio 2010
 Remote MPI debugging with Visual Studio 2010
 General MPI tracing
 Tracing with ETW (Event Tracing for Windows)
 Trace visualization
 Other tools for MPI developers: perfmon, resmon, and xperf
 Common performance problems in MPI

Module 9: MPI Application Design

This module presents the most common design issues facing MPI developers.

Lessons

 Hiding latency by overlapping computation and communication
 Non-blocking communication
 Safety: detecting and avoiding deadlock
 MPI.NET
 Hybrid designs involving both MPI and OpenMP
 Buffering, error handling, I/O, and large datasets
 Remote memory access

Module 10: Intro to SOA with HPC Server 2008 R2

This module presents one of the most interesting and unique features of Windows HPC Server 2008 R2 — service-oriented HPC.

Lessons

 Service-oriented architectures
 SOA and WCF
 Mapping SOA onto Jobs and the Job Scheduler
 Private vs. shared sessions
 Secure vs. insecure sessions
 Volatile vs. durable sessions

Lab : Consuming a HPC-based SOA Service

 Deploying a SOA service
 Building a desktop client to communicate with a SOA service
 Working with volatile SOA sessions
 Working with durable SOA sessions

Module 11: Create SOA-based Apps with HPC Server 2008 R2

This module presents the details of building a SOA-based HPC app, from start to finish.

Lessons

 Service-side programming
 Service configuration
 Client-side programming options
 Proxies: Async WCF vs. HPC BrokerClient, Enumeration vs. Callback

Lab : SOA-based HPC with HPCS and WCF

 Creating a SOA service from scratch
 Deploying a SOA service
 Develop a client-side app to communicate using WCF proxy
 Develop a client-side app to communicate using HPC BrokerClient proxy
 Call a service with multiple entry points, concurrently

Module 12: SOA Debugging, Tracing, and Performance Tuning

This module discusses various performance tuning strategies on Windows for parallel apps.

Lessons

 Local SOA debugging with Visual Studio 2010
 Remote SOA debugging with Visual Studio 2010
 Low-level tracing with WCF
 Enabling WCF tracing via HPC Cluster Manager
 Common performance problems with SOA-based HPC apps
 Troubleshooting SOA services

Module 13: HPC Services for Excel 2010

This module presents techniques for bringing the potential of high-performance computing to the world of spreadsheets.

Lessons

 Excel as a computation engine
 Performing Excel computations on Windows HPC Server 2008 R2
 Using HPC Services for Excel 2010 to run workbooks on the cluster
 Using Excel UDFs to run parallel computations on the cluster

Module 14: Designing for Workstation and Azure nodes

This module discusses the design of applications that take advantage of on-premise Win7 workstations, as well as off-premise Azure nodes.

Lessons

 Additional compute resources: on-premise workstations and off-premise Azure nodes
 Taking advantage of Workstation nodes
 Taking advantage of Azure nodes

Module 15: Supporting and Emerging Technologies

This module presents brief overview of supporting and emerging technologies around HPC Server 2008 R2.

Lessons

 GPU computing with CUDA and HPC Server 2008 R2
 Virtual Shared Memory with AppFabric Caching
 Large data processing with Dryad and DryadLINQ
 Cluster data reporting via the HPC Server API
